## Proctoring Queue

The Oakspire proctoring queue routes exam-session jobs to review workers. Read `docs/queue-overview.md` before touching anything. Contractors get read-only dashboard access by default; request write access through your lead. Never purge jobs — each one is a live exam session. Deploys go through the standard pipeline only. Questions about queue behavior or access go to the platform team at the address below.

alerts address for yajof-kahog: eliax@qirvanlabs.corp

## Further Reading

Sort stability matters in Ledgerloom's report builder: grouped exports rely on stable ordering to keep subtotal rows adjacent to their parents. The default comparator was swapped to a stable merge sort in v4.2 after customers saw subtotal drift in large exports. Do not reintroduce the quicksort path, even for performance — the regression is subtle and only appears past ~50k rows. Benchmarks, the original bug writeup, and the comparator design rationale are collected on the internal page here.

operations page: https://jenkins.zemvarcloud.local/job/merge_requests/repo/build/73930b4b30f0a8ed

Runbook: GarageGlance occupancy feed

If the Harborview Deck occupancy feed goes stale (no updates for 5+ minutes), first check the sensor gateway health page. Green but stale usually means the aggregator queue is backed up; restart the aggregator via the ops console and counts should recover within two minutes. If spots show negative numbers, force a full recount from the camera snapshots. When escalating to engineering, include the trace token shown below.

session token of yawif-kahof = htk9_dd6996ed6